GETTING STARTED

How Ledora actually works

A step-by-step look at both sides — hiring and freelancing.

IF YOU'RE HIRING
1

Post a project

Title, category, description, and a budget range. Optionally add reference images or a video walkthrough.

2

Pick how you want to browse

Swipe through profiles one at a time, search and compare a full grid, or run a head-to-head tournament to narrow down a shortlist.

3

Review proposals

Freelancers apply directly to your project with a price and a cover message. Accept, decline, or message them first.

4

Work together, then leave a review

Once the work is done, a written review updates their public rating — which is what actually lowers their platform fee over time.

IF YOU'RE FREELANCING
1

Set up your profile

Category, portfolio photos, an intro video link if you have one, tags so people can find you, and your pricing — hourly, a starting price, or both.

2

Get discovered three ways

Clients find you by swiping, searching, or through a tournament matchup — same profile, different context each time.

3

Apply to open projects

Browse posted projects and send a proposal with your price and approach. Track every proposal's status from your account page.

4

Build a rating that pays you back

Every review nudges your average up. Higher ratings unlock lower platform fees — Rising, Trusted, then Elite.
